Obituary of Harold LeRoux
It is with great sadness that the family of the late Harold LeRoux announce his passing at the Dr. Hugh Twomey Health Centre, Botwood, NL on Tuesday December 21, 2021 at the age of 91. He leaves to mourn with fond and loving memories his loving and devoted wife: Margaret, daughter: Kim (Fred Penney), Grand Falls-Windsor, NL; son: Randy, St. Alban’s. NL; grandchildren: Lee & Lucy; special family friend: Phyllis Barnes, St. Alban’s, NL, as well as a large circle of other nephews, nieces relatives and friends. He was predeceased by his son: Scott; daughter: Ann; brothers: Sam, Stan & Kevin (Rosanne); parents: Leo & Ann; step mother: Ida; nephew: Scott. Harold was a devoted husband, father & grandfather. He was deeply connected to the land and loved berry picking, fishing, hiking and taking his family to the beach, where he taught his grandson to skip rocks. Harold loved being a jokester with family and friends but usually did not succeed because his grin would give him away. His granddaughter inherited his lokester spirit and was known for having “that Harold LeRoux grin” when she was young. Harold will be deeply missed by his family, friends and all who knew him. His memory will be kept alive through all the wonderful stories he told, especially those about his children and grandchildren, it is believed that his spirit has returned to his favorite berry picking spot, happily spending time with the rest of his relatives who have preceeded him. The family extends a special thank you to homecare workers Sadie Sutton & Phyllis Skinner and the staff at the Dr. Hugh Twomey Health Centre for providing comfort and care as Harold walked the final stage of his life on earth. There will not be any Funeral service at this time. Funeral Arrangements were entrusted to Hynes’ Coast of Bays Funeral Home, St. Alban’s.
